Matalan

Matalan, a UK-based omnichannel retailer that operates in the UK and internationally, with 230 UK shops and 49 franchises across the world It offers a variety of fashion and household brands at affordable prices. The company recently added 10 new brands from third-party fashion to its lineup including Quiz, Yumi, Blue Vanilla, Roman, Mela London, Where's That From, Izabel, Brand Threads and Toe Zone.

The company's copy team will continue to supervise descriptions of products. They will review details like material content, and then edit to ensure the tone of voice. Marks and Spencer, or M&S, is a British multinational retailer that offers food, clothing cosmetics, furniture, and home appliances. It has 703 stores across the United Kingdom and abroad and Shopping Online uk clothes employs approximately 138,000 employees. The company is headquartered in London, England. The firm began life in 1884 when Jewish refugee Michael Marks opened a stall in an open market in Leeds. The stall's sign read: "Don't Ask the Price It's a penny". When the business became successful, Marks decided to seek an investor and invited Thomas Spencer to join him. Spencer contributed 300 pounds, and his experience in accounting and management complemented Marks flair for selling and selling merchandise.

M&S stores were built in the beginning to adapt to changing social and economic conditions. Marks adapted to the changing social climate by utilizing open displays, which encouraged browsing and self selection. During this time the company's size increased. By 1915, it had 145 stores.

M&S began to develop its own brands in the 1960s. This included the introduction of synthetic fibres like Tricell and Coutelle and machine washable woollens. In the 1980s, lingerie took on a fashion edge with coordinated sets inspired by catwalk styles.

M&S is committed to decreasing its impact on the environment. It has developed 100-point plan that covers all aspects of its business, from in-store heating to product labels. The goal of the plan is to cut down on emissions, encourage healthy eating, develop fair partnerships, and use sustainable raw materials.

H&M

Established in 1947, Hennes & Mauritz AB is the second-largest retailer of fashion in the world. Its success is based on its speed of fashion. This means identifying trends and getting low-cost copies of the latest trends to stores as quickly as it is possible. Unlike other retailers, which is the best online supermarket might take months to develop and create new designs, H&M can create a new collection in only two weeks. The stores at H&M are always filled with new clothing.

H&M is not just known for its extensive range of services and products, is also known for their social responsibility initiatives. The company has pledged to minimize its impact on the environment and to pay employees an income that is sustainable by 2030. It also supports a clothing collection program that allows customers to donate used clothes.

The H&M app allows online and offline shopping. The app allows customers to shop for their favorite items and receive notifications of special deals. The app's visual search feature lets users snap a photo of a style they like and will show similar items in stock. The app also comes with the option of a click-and-collect and free returns option.
